For the living room sofa, we chose a fluffy, armless velvet model, paired with a glass coffee table to visually expand the compact space. The soft upholstered sofa and glass table create a serene, leisurely ambiance, bringing layered natural textures and an organic feel. Whether reading or watching a film, time spent nestling on the couch feels effortlessly beautiful.

The living room’s feature wall combines large‑area white grilles with wood tones, softening the heaviness of the spatial volumes.
A passageway that runs through all the spaces features a continuous row of storage, accommodating both a sideboard and a washer‑dryer combo, significantly enhancing the home’s storage capacity.

At mealtime in the dining area, you can gaze out toward the sun‑drenched bedroom; the sunlight is filtered through sheer curtains, so even at noon the light remains soft. A wooden table with a white textured finish, accented by rattan chairs, sets a warm and inviting tone for everyday life.

The kitchen features staggered countertops for added convenience.

In the master bedroom, an elegant aesthetic harmonizes with the power of negative space. By avoiding excessive ornamentation, the pure, refined base becomes even more unadorned. A half‑wall of raw wood at the head of the bed, combined with cream‑gray latex paint, lends depth to the space, while sheer curtains at the window further enhance the comfort of this restful retreat.

The bathroom features a clear separation between wet and dry areas; the floating vanity makes cleaning easy, and the dry zone includes cabinets that neatly house the washer and dryer. Open shelves along the washbasin provide convenient storage for daily toiletries.

The minimalist, barrier‑free shower enclosure is both practical and aesthetically pleasing.
